Key Features to Look for in 2026 Sports TVs

  • High Refresh Rates: Look for models with 120Hz or higher for smooth motion during fast-paced sports.
  • Low Input Lag: Essential for real-time viewing, especially if you enjoy gaming alongside watching sports.
  • HDR Support: Enhanced contrast and color accuracy make game details pop.
  • Smart TV Capabilities: Built-in apps and voice control for easy access to streaming services.
  • Connectivity: Multiple HDMI ports, including HDMI 2.1, for connecting gaming consoles and streaming devices.

Timing Your Purchase for Maximum Value

To get the best deals and latest technology, consider purchasing your sports TV during key sales periods. The best times include:

  • Post-CES Sales (January-February): Manufacturers often discount older models after new releases.
  • Spring Sales (March-May): Retailers offer spring promotions on electronics.
  • Black Friday and Holiday Sales (November): Major discounts on high-end models, perfect for game day viewing.

Tips for Setting Up Your Sports TV

Once you’ve purchased your new TV, optimize it for sports viewing:

  • Position the TV at eye level for comfortable viewing.
  • Use a dedicated sports mode if available to enhance motion and color.
  • Ensure your internet connection is fast and stable for streaming high-definition content.
  • Adjust picture settings to maximize contrast and clarity during fast action sequences.
